#b40651 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b40651 is composed of 70.6% red, 2.4%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.7% magenta, 55%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 334.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 36.5%. #b40651 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0ca2 with #690000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

● #b40651 color description : Strong pink.
The hexadecimal color #b40651 has RGB values of R:180, G:6,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.55,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11798097.
